Imagined Future Scenarios

Hospitals deploy IoT sensor networks to monitor patient vitals remotely, enabling personalized treatment plans and early detection of health anomalies.

Internet of Things, Plausible Futures, Medium Term (3 - 5 years)

Scenario Generated from 'Interview with DeepSeek Founder: We're Done Following. It's Time to Lead' - Thechinaacademy.org

Future Arc and Implications

Grow Arc

Social Impact: Increased lifespan and improved quality of life lead to an aging population and shifting social demographics.

Technological Impact: Ubiquitous IoT sensors generate vast health data, driving AI-powered diagnostics and personalized medicine advancements.

Ecological Impact: Increased electronic waste from disposable sensors and energy consumption of data centers strain environmental resources.

Economic Impact: The health-tech industry booms, creating new jobs and markets while increasing healthcare expenditure.

Political Impact: Governments invest in IoT infrastructure and data security regulations, striving for equitable access and data privacy.

Narrative: Continuous technological advancement leads to readily accessible and improved healthcare, fueling global population growth and economic expansion.


Collapse Arc

Social Impact: Widespread system failures and data breaches erode trust in healthcare technology, causing anxiety and social unrest.

Technological Impact: IoT infrastructure becomes vulnerable to cyberattacks, leading to sensor malfunction, data manipulation, and compromised patient health.

Ecological Impact: Uncontrolled e-waste disposal from failed sensors contaminates ecosystems and poses health risks.

Economic Impact: Healthcare systems are overwhelmed by cascading failures, leading to economic recession and diminished access to care.

Political Impact: Government failures in regulating cybersecurity and data privacy lead to political instability and loss of public confidence.

Narrative: Systemic failures in IoT infrastructure and cybersecurity lead to a breakdown in healthcare services and societal trust.


Discipline Arc

Social Impact: Society accepts rigorous health monitoring and data sharing as a necessary trade-off for collective well-being and pandemic preparedness.

Technological Impact: Centralized AI algorithms analyze patient data to enforce health compliance and optimize healthcare resource allocation.

Ecological Impact: Resource management is optimized through sensor-driven insights, aiming to minimize environmental impact and maximize efficiency.

Economic Impact: Healthcare costs are controlled through data-driven resource allocation, potentially leading to rationing and limited choices.

Political Impact: A powerful governing body enforces strict data privacy regulations and mandates health monitoring to ensure public safety.

Narrative: A highly controlled system prioritizes collective health through centralized data analysis, compliance enforcement, and resource optimization.


Transform Arc

Social Impact: Individuals gain greater autonomy over their health through decentralized IoT solutions and open-source health data platforms.

Technological Impact: Decentralized blockchain technology ensures secure and transparent data sharing, fostering trust and innovation in personalized health solutions.

Ecological Impact: Sustainable and biodegradable sensor technologies minimize environmental impact and promote circular economy principles.

Economic Impact: The democratization of health data empowers individuals to participate in health research and benefit from the value of their data.

Political Impact: A shift towards individual empowerment strengthens civic participation and demands for greater transparency and accountability in healthcare governance.

Narrative: Technological advancements and a shift in values empower individuals to take control of their health through decentralized, transparent, and sustainable solutions.
